Hi All, I have 19 tables with 50 odd attributes each and their datatypes within a csv.(field_name, datatype, Width, Precision). I am writting out to ESRI file GSB.
How do i set the writers data type from this list. I have tried importing the csv the using the "duplicate on writer" function. This is great for setting the name of the writer attributes but doesnt set the data Type fields. Is this possible ? Any suggestions to save me from setting 1000 data types manually.

Hi Steve,
I don't think there is a way to import schema definition to static writer feature types from an external schema definition table.
Instead, I would recommend you to consider applying the Dynamic Schema mechanism (Lookup Table method).
To apply the method, you will have to create a lookup table, but I think it will not take so long time since you already have a CSV table which describes all the required schema definition. You can modify the CSV table easily to fit the requirement for the look up table format.
